Pathogenic And Biological Characterization Of T-DNA Insertion Mutants In Colletotrichum Gloeosporioides Casual Organism Of Apple Anthracnose

The apple anthracnose leaf spot caused by C.gloeosporioides is an important disease of apple in recent years in China.16 T-DNA insertion mutants of C.gloeosporioides were selected from a mutant library which created through ATMT method,the pathology and biology characters were further studied.Through this study,the relative pathogenicity-associated genes were selected,the better condition for colony growth and sporulation were identified,and it is helpful for the further study on their pathogenicity mechanism and for the management of the disease.The main results of the study are as follow:Through inoculation test on wound apple fruit,5 pathogenicity related insertion mutants were screened out,among of them,mutants A4204,M44,A3638 and A1598 lost the pathogenic capability completely,mutant A1919 and A1643 produced slightly symptoms on wound apple fruits.Insertion mutant A3638 had poor colony growth in all medium,means that this gene is also positively control the vegetative growth.Sporulation of mutant A4204 increased obviously compared with wild isolate stj16,means the gene A4204 negatively control the conidia production,bioinformatics analysis and subcellular location of the protein A4202 identified its function on cell division;4 insertion mutants(M44,A2983,A3144 and G1183)strongly decreased the sporulation of the fungi,it means that they positively control the production of the conidia.Biology study indicated that: 1)the Rose Bengal Agar(RBA)medium decreased the mycelium growth,but it can increase the sporulation for most of the isolates;2)most of the isolates fit to a large p H range(from p H4.0 – p H8.0),but mutant A4204 doesn‘t grow well at p H4.0 and p H8.0,and mutant M44 just has optimum grew at p H8.0;3)12h light and 12 h dark condition stimulate the sporulation for most of tested mutants,but A1764 mutant more sporulated at regular dark condition.Based on the biology study,the best growing and sporulation condition for all the tested isolateswere found.All the mutants and stj16 grew vigorously at 25?C?30?C,for stj16,it produced the highest number of conidia at 30?C compared with other temperature,it explained the environment condition of the field for benefit the breaking of the disease,namely the pathogen can break fast and cause severe damage in the high humid condition and rainy season in the summer.
